OverviewThe work deals with the relationship of temporary bankruptcy administration to the bankruptcy dispute in the opened proceeding. This theme generally receives great attention in case law and literature. However, the particular questions to which the work is dedicated have not been previously addressed at the center of academic discourse, although they are of great practical relevance both for the temporary bankruptcy administrator and the creditors. In fact, a circular argument exists between the security of the assets and the equal treatment of creditors in the temporary bankruptcy proceeding. This clearly emerges if not only the debtor, but also the temporary bankruptcy administrator is involved in the disputed legal action, and if the opposing party refers to his confidence in the legally validity of the legal action. Both decisions of the BGH [German Federal Supreme Court] from March 13, 2003, which are the focus of the work, deal with this combination.
